Anti-A Titre Test – Serum
Overview:
The Anti-A titre test measures the amount (titre) of anti-A antibodies present in an individual’s serum. This test is particularly important in the context of blood transfusion compatibility, organ transplantation, and maternal-fetal blood group incompatibility.
Anti-A antibodies are naturally occurring in people who lack A antigens on their red blood cells—primarily individuals with blood group B or O.
Sample Type:
Serum (blood sample)
A blood sample is drawn, serum is separated, and the level of anti-A antibodies is determined through serial dilution and agglutination methods.
Purpose of the Test:
To determine antibody titre levels in individuals with blood group B or O
To assess risk of hemolytic transfusion reaction before giving incompatible blood
Evaluate hemolytic disease of the newborn (HDN) risk when there is ABO incompatibility between mother and fetus
Used in organ transplantation, especially for ABO-incompatible kidney or liver transplants, to guide desensitization protocols
How the Test Works:
The patient’s serum is mixed with type A red blood cells in varying dilutions
The highest dilution at which agglutination (clumping) occurs is recorded as the titre value
A higher titre means more anti-A antibodies are present
Interpretation of Results:
Low titre: Low level of anti-A antibodies; lower risk of immune reaction
High titre: High concentration of anti-A antibodies; may pose risk in transfusion or transplantation scenarios
In pregnancy, high maternal anti-A titres may increase the risk of ABO hemolytic disease of the newborn
Note: Normal titres vary depending on lab protocols, population, and purpose of testing.
Clinical Significance:
Helps prevent transfusion reactions
Guides organ transplant compatibility decisions
Assists in maternal-fetal monitoring in ABO-incompatible pregnancies
Supports safe cross-matching practices in blood banks
Limitations:
Titre levels may fluctuate over time or after exposure to antigens (e.g., transfusion, pregnancy)
Must be interpreted along with clinical history and blood group typing
Does not assess Rh antibodies (separate testing required for Rh incompatibility)
